    Account security

    Eh this seems like kind of a seedy thing to be asking... but does anyone have any suggestions for how to go about ensuring not getting screwed over while trading accounts (trade, not buying). Long story short, I can't recover my old account which I foolishly deleted... a friend gave me one to play on which I've been using for a few months, but the original owner of that account is now playing again and wants his account back dearly, and is willing to trade a very nice character in return.

    I do feel bad because if it were the same situation reversed I'd really want my account back, and I know that at some point way back his account was stolen (a bunch of people before I got it, I was told the original guy quit a long time ago so I agreed to play on it).

    So anyways, I have another content ID where I can put all my gil/equip that isn't rare/ex, and so does he. I'm looking for this situation to be a happy one where we both get what we want.

    So what info do I need to make sure that the account can't be taken back at some point of the future?

    -Is it sufficient to simply gain access and change the credit card info, and is getting the registration info required? I believe I could go on his account first and change the info because he is so desperate to get his account back he'd be willing to trust me (I'm not gonna screw him).

    -Anyone know if I can get some temporary credit card (like a card with 40 bucks on it or something, set to expire after the money is spent) to put as the info on my current account so I don't have to worry about my real CC info being stolen in a shitty RL situation?

    Any info would be appreciated.

    http://www.simon.com or http://www.giftcards.com - Virtual gift cards loaded as low as $25. They are Visa's and treated the exact same as credit cards. That should suit your purpose.

    As far as getting onto his account first, it is vital that you change both the credit card info and password. As for as the membership info (address, etc.) I'm not exactly sure if you need to change that but it cant help. When I was recalling my account they said I didn't need it, but maybe that was because I had my reg codes.

    The most someone else can see when logging on your account is your billing name and address. The credit card number is x'd out so they won't be able to steal that, and the POL help desk/phone support won't give out credit card information, so there's really no need to use a gift card.

    Like the last poster said, change the credit card info and POL password as soon as you get the account. As long as your friend doesn't know either there's no way he can get back into that account.
